The working principle is as follows:
firstly, before use, the device is placed in the shell 1, when the device is used, the button 4 can open the device, the USB socket 5 can be connected with data, the first heat dissipation port 6 and the second heat dissipation port 7 play a role in heat dissipation, the sealing plate 3 plays a role in connection, and the panel 2 plays a role in sealing;
secondly, when maintenance is needed, a user firstly holds the poke rod 81 in the convenient installation device 8 and presses downwards, the poke rod 81 drives the slide rod 825 to slide downwards and install on the inner wall of the slide groove 824 in the square hole 823, so that the sliding function is realized, the poke rod 81 presses the spring 83 downwards, after the spring 83 is compressed, meanwhile, the poke rod 81 drives the clamping rod 87 to rotate around the fixed shaft 86, so that the clamping rod 87 is separated from the clamping groove seat 88, and then holds the handle 822 to take down one corner of the plate body 821;
secondly, after the remaining three groups of clamping rods 87 are separated from the clamping groove seats 88 in sequence, the handle 822 is held by a hand to take down the other triangle of the plate body 821, and then the connecting plate 82 is taken down, wherein the jack 801 plays a role in connection, the connecting column 802 plays a role in connection, the empty groove 84 plays a role in connection, and the connecting block 85 plays a role in connection, so that the convenient disassembly is realized, and the problems that the bolt is required to be separated from the computer shell by a tool, the overhauling is inconvenient, and the maintenance efficiency is reduced are solved;
thirdly, after the maintenance is completed, the convenient installation device 8 is installed back to the right end of the shell 1.
